Handover — bike cage and parking gates, Ostrell Building. Morning checks: confirm the cage latch closes fully and both Penley Street gates respond to the reader. If a team member's fob fails, log it with facilities and direct them to the side gate. For anyone needing access before a replacement fob arrives, share the fallback code below.

badge for bajop-hahip: bdg-YL-7

Subject: Quickstore 4.2 — bloom filter now fronts the KV layer

Plugin authors: starting with this release, Quickstore places a bloom filter ahead of the key-value store. Negative lookups return faster; false positives fall through safely. No API changes are required on your side. Verify your plugin against the staging build referenced below.

session token of fahif-tadup = htk3_9c7

**Ticket: Crashfold vault locked — reviewer action needed**

The Marrowtide crash-report pipeline for the Skylark mobile app stopped ingesting symbols after the signing vault auto-locked during last night's rotation. Dedupe jobs are queuing; nothing lost yet. Review the attached unlock diff — it only touches the vault client retry logic, not symbolication. Don't merge until you've confirmed the staging vault opens cleanly. To unlock staging yourself, use the recovery passphrase provided directly below this line.

recovery phrase for yawep-bagaf: ralax-silwyn-sorius

**Vendor note: Inkmill markdown pipeline**

Rendering for Parchway docs is outsourced to Inkmill under an annual contract, renewing each March. They handle sanitization and PDF export; we own the upload queue. SLA: 4-hour response on rendering failures. Escalate only after two failed retries. Their support desk is reachable at the address below.

billing contact of hahaf-baguf = zorael.tammir.jorius@sivrelhq.internal